Usuwanie i odzyskiwanie usuniętych plików z dysku USB lub zewnętrznego dysku SSD
Usuwanie i odzyskiwanie usuniętych plików z dysku USB lub zewnętrznego dysku SSD
Anonim

W gościnnym artykule Valery Martyshko z Hetman Software dzieli się z czytelnikami Lifehacker, jak odzyskać pliki usunięte z zewnętrznego dysku SSD lub zwykłego pendrive'a, a także podpowiada, jak chronić dane przed nieautoryzowanym dostępem za pomocą szyfrowania.

Usuwanie i odzyskiwanie usuniętych plików z dysku USB lub zewnętrznego dysku SSD
Usuwanie i odzyskiwanie usuniętych plików z dysku USB lub zewnętrznego dysku SSD

Panuje ogólnie przyjęty pogląd, że nie da się odzyskać danych na dysku SSD, że można to zrobić tylko na zwykłym dysku twardym. Ale dotyczy to tylko osadzonych mediów. Pliki na dyskach flash USB i zewnętrznych dyskach półprzewodnikowych (SSD) można odzyskać, co często jest postrzegane jako luka w prywatności.

Ale z drugiej strony jest dobrze. Na takich urządzeniach można odzyskać przypadkowo usunięte pliki, co oczywiście jest przydatną funkcją. Z drugiej strony osoby nieuprawnione mogą to wykorzystać, aby uzyskać dostęp do poufnych informacji.

1 odzyskiwanie usuniętych plików
1 odzyskiwanie usuniętych plików

Dlaczego nie możesz odzyskać usuniętych plików z wbudowanego dysku SSD

Powód, dla którego pliki można odzyskać na zwykłym dysku twardym komputera, jest bardzo prosty. Kiedy usuwasz plik z takiego dysku, w zasadzie nie jest on usuwany. Dane te pozostają na dysku twardym, są po prostu oznaczane przez system jako usunięte. System operacyjny przechowuje informacje, dopóki nie potrzebuje więcej miejsca na dysku do przechowywania innych danych.

Nie ma sensu, aby system operacyjny natychmiast usuwał sektory, ponieważ wydłuży to proces usuwania plików. Zapisywanie informacji w poprzednio używanym sektorze zajmuje tyle samo czasu, co zapisywanie informacji w pustym sektorze. Ze względu na dużą ilość takich usuniętych danych oprogramowanie do odzyskiwania danych może skanować dysk twardy w poszukiwaniu nieużywanego miejsca i odzyskiwać informacje, które nie zostały jeszcze nadpisane.

Dyski SSD działają inaczej. Zanim jakiekolwiek dane zostaną zapisane w lokalizacji pamięci flash, ta lokalizacja jest wstępnie wyczyszczona. Nowe dyski są początkowo puste, a nagrywanie na nich przebiega tak szybko, jak to możliwe. Na pełnym dysku z usuniętymi wieloma plikami proces zapisu jest wolniejszy, ponieważ każda komórka musi zostać wyczyszczona, zanim będzie można ją zapisać. Oznacza to, że dysk SSD będzie z czasem zwalniał. Aby tego uniknąć, wprowadzono TRIM.

TRIM (od angielskiego do trim) to polecenie interfejsu ATA, które umożliwia systemowi operacyjnemu powiadamianie dysku SSD, które bloki danych nie są już zawarte w systemie plików i mogą być używane przez dysk do fizycznego usunięcia.

Gdy system operacyjny usuwa pliki z wbudowanego dysku SSD, wywołuje polecenie TRIM i natychmiast usuwa dane sektora. Przyspiesza to proces zapisu w przyszłości i sprawia, że odzyskanie danych na takim dysku jest prawie niemożliwe.

TRIM działa tylko z wbudowanymi napędami

Uważa się więc, że odzyskanie plików na dysku SSD jest niemożliwe. Ale tak nie jest, ponieważ jest jedno bardzo ważne zastrzeżenie: TRIM jest obsługiwany tylko przez wbudowane (wewnętrzne) dyski. Nie jest obsługiwany przez interfejsy USB ani FireWire. Innymi słowy, gdy usuniesz plik z dysku flash USB, zewnętrznego dysku SSD, karty pamięci SD lub innego typu dysku SSD, system po prostu oznaczy go jako usunięty i można go odzyskać.

Oznacza to, że możesz odzyskać dane na dowolnych dyskach zewnętrznych w taki sam sposób, jak na zwykłym dysku twardym. W rzeczywistości takie nośniki są jeszcze bardziej podatne na ataki niż konwencjonalny wbudowany dysk twardy – łatwiej je ukraść. Można je gdzieś zostawić, pożyczyć lub zgubić.

Spróbuj sam

Możesz sam spróbować. Weź dysk flash USB, podłącz go do komputera i skopiuj na niego pliki. Usuń te pliki i uruchom program, aby odzyskać usunięte dane. Zeskanuj nim dysk flash USB, a program zobaczy wszystkie usunięte pliki i zaproponuje ich przywrócenie.

SSD1 Odzyskiwanie usuniętych plików
SSD1 Odzyskiwanie usuniętych plików

Szybki format nie pomoże

A co z formatowaniem? Sformatujmy dysk flash i nic nie zostanie przywrócone! W końcu formatowanie usuwa wszystkie pliki na nośniku i tworzy nowy system plików.

Aby to przetestować, sformatujmy nasz dysk flash przy użyciu domyślnego szybkiego formatu. Tak, rzeczywiście, używając szybkiego skanowania, Hetman Partition Recovery nie był w stanie wykryć usuniętych plików. Ale głębsza pełna analiza pozwoliła znaleźć dużą liczbę usuniętych plików, które znajdowały się na dysku flash przed jego sformatowaniem.

Odzyskiwanie usuniętych plików SSD4
Odzyskiwanie usuniętych plików SSD4

Usuń zaznaczenie pola szybkiego formatowania i sformatuj je ponownie. Następnie programowi trudno jest znaleźć usunięte pliki.

Screenshot_3 odzyskaj usunięte pliki
Screenshot_3 odzyskaj usunięte pliki

Jak się upewnić, że usuniętych plików nie można już odzyskać?

Możesz użyć rozwiązań szyfrowania, takich jak TrueCrypt, Microsoft BitLocker, wbudowany Mac OS lub Linux. Wtedy nikt nie będzie w stanie odzyskać usuniętych plików bez klucza, a to ochroni wszystkie pliki na nośniku, w tym usunięte.

Ale jest to ważne tylko wtedy, gdy nośnik jest używany do przechowywania ważnych danych. Jeśli jest to dysk flash do słuchania muzyki w samochodzie, to oczywiście nie trzeba go szyfrować.

Odzyskiwanie usuniętych plików SSD3
Odzyskiwanie usuniętych plików SSD3

TRIM to funkcja, która pomaga w pełni wykorzystać wbudowany dysk SSD. Nie jest to jednak funkcja zabezpieczająca. Wiele osób uważa, że gwarantuje trwałe usunięcie danych z dowolnych nośników półprzewodnikowych. Tak nie jest - możesz odzyskać dane na dowolnym dysku zewnętrznym. Pamiętaj, aby wziąć to pod uwagę podczas usuwania poufnych lub tylko ważnych danych.

Zalecana: